Performance
The Snapdragon 888 in the X60t Pro+ is significantly more powerful than the Dimensity 1200 in the X70. Expect smoother multitasking, faster app loading times, and better gaming performance on the X60t Pro+. The Dimensity 1200 is still capable, but it won't match the raw power of the Snapdragon.
Battery Life
The X60t Pro+ has a clear advantage with its 55W wired charging compared to the X70's 44W. Both phones likely have similar battery capacities (around 4200-4400mAh), so the X60t Pro+ will charge significantly faster.
